How they compare

Mali currently reports 230,785 US dollar against 0 US dollar in Sint Maarten (Dutch part), a difference of 230,785 US dollar.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 7 shared years of data; in 2015 it was Mali ahead.

Mali ranks 102nd and Sint Maarten (Dutch part) ranks 105th of 147 countries.

Mali has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

The International Investment Position (IIP) is a statistical statement that shows at a point in time the value of financial assets of residents of an economy that are claims on nonresidents or are gold bullion held as reserve assets; and the liabilities of residents of an economy to nonresidents.
